Adopting an English Bulldog in Long Beach is a rewarding journey that combines the unique charm of this beloved breed with the vibrant lifestyle of our coastal city. Known for their affectionate nature and distinctive wrinkled faces, English Bulldogs are a favorite among dog lovers. However, their laid-back demeanor makes them especially well-suited to the relaxed vibe of Long Beach.

English Bulldogs thrive in environments where they can enjoy moderate exercise and plenty of family time. Long Beach offers a variety of dog-friendly parks and cafes, making it an ideal setting for these adorable companions. The city’s mild climate is perfect for an English Bulldog, who often prefers cooler temperatures. It’s important to remember that while they enjoy a leisurely stroll, these pups are not built for strenuous activity, which aligns perfectly with the city’s laid-back atmosphere.

When considering adopting an English Bulldog in Long Beach, it’s crucial to evaluate how well the breed fits into your lifestyle. The breed is known for its loyalty and gentle temper, making it an excellent choice for families and first-time dog owners. However, prospective adopters should be aware of the breed’s unique health requirements, including regular vet check-ups, to ensure a happy and healthy pet.

Best Long Beach Spots for Your English Bulldog

Once your English Bulldog has settled in, you’ll find plenty of great places around Long Beach to explore together.

  • Rosie’s Dog Beach: This off-leash beach is perfect for a leisurely romp, allowing your Bulldog to enjoy the ocean breeze without overheating.
  • Signal Hill Park: Offers shaded walking trails ideal for short, relaxing walks that match the English Bulldog’s exercise needs.
  • Aroma di Roma Café: A pet-friendly café where you can enjoy a coffee while your Bulldog lounges by your side.
  • El Dorado Park: With expansive green spaces, this park is perfect for a picnic and some light playtime for your Bulldog.

Q: What are the care needs of an English Bulldog in Long Beach’s climate?
A: In Long Beach, English Bulldogs benefit from the mild climate but should avoid excessive heat. Ensure they have access to cool spaces and limit outdoor activity during peak temperatures.
